brandend81076  created a new article
16 w ·Translate

The Ultimate Guide to Slot Sites | #online Casino Games

The Ultimate Guide to Slot Sites

The Ultimate Guide to Slot Sites

Welcome to the world of online slot sites, the place leisure and potential riches await at the click on of a button.